A leading dental network in the UK is seeking a Self-employed Associate Dentist in Bolton. You will join a well-established practice with flexible working hours, providing both private and NHS dental services.
The position offers excellent earnings potential, support for training and development, and a welcoming practice environment. You will be part of a dedicated team focused on exceptional patient care and continuous improvements in service delivery.
